A leading Financial Services organisation is looking to secure a Senior Corporate M&A Lawyer for an initial 6 month contract.
This role reports to the Head of Legal (Corporate) and is a hybrid role (2 days a week in the office).
This role sits within the Corporate Legal Team, who provide corporate legal support on a range of matters including acquisitions and disposals, equity investments, joint ventures, intra-group reorganisations and transactions, company secretarial and corporate governance matters, corporate disclosure and financial reporting requirements.
Your key accountabilities will include:
Providing legal advice to internal clients which ensures compliance with legal and regulatory requirements and balances legal risk with commercial need
Assisting with the instruction and management of panel law firms and development of strong relationships with external lawyers
Working with internal stakeholders and (where appropriate) external advisers on Corporate Legal aspects of Group ESG disclosures including annual TCFD Reports, External Sector Statements and NZBA disclosures
Negotiating the terms of transaction documentation in conjunction with internal stakeholders such as Group Corporate Development, Finance, Tax and Risk, to ensure legal risk in relation to such transactions is appropriately managed and mitigated
About you:
5+ PQE (though all candidates will be considered on merit)
Extensive corporate experience, ideally in an in-house environment
Experience within Financial Services
Available to start within 6 weeks
